Product Description

The WALTER Diamond Turning Insert (SKU 7560027, MPN 7560027) is a diamond indexable turning insert available in two variants: CNMG432-MU5 and CNMG120408-MU5. These inserts are designed for turning operations and are supplied by WALTER.

Frequently Asked Questions

What is the WALTER Diamond Turning Insert used for?

The WALTER Diamond Turning Insert is used for precision turning operations on non-ferrous materials, composites, and abrasive workpieces. Its diamond composition provides high wear resistance and long tool life in finishing and semi-finishing applications across automotive, aerospace, and general machining industries.

What are the specifications of the WALTER Diamond Turning Insert?

The WALTER Diamond Turning Insert is available in two variants: CNMG432-MU5 and CNMG120408-MU5, with manufacturer part number 7560027. Both are indexable turning inserts designed for turning operations. The CNMG432-MU5 corresponds to ISO designation CNMG120408-MU5. WALTER supplies these inserts for industrial machining.

How to select the right WALTER Diamond Turning Insert?

Select the WALTER Diamond Turning Insert based on your workpiece material and operation. The CNMG432-MU5 (CNMG120408-MU5) is suited for finishing and semi-finishing of non-ferrous metals and composites. Match the insert geometry to your tool holder and cutting conditions. Consult WALTER's technical documentation for specific feed and speed recommendations.
